What You Need to Know About the 2025 Toyota Prius

If you're looking for a fuel-savvy vehicle that won't break the bank, you'll want to take a look at the 2025 Toyota Prius, a reliable sedan known for its impressive efficiency, practical design, and innovative technology. Performance and Fuel Efficiency The Prius features a 2.0L 4-cylinder engine and permanent magnet AC synchronous motor. This hybrid system is capable of generating up to 194 horsepower and 139 lb-ft of torque, making it quite the powerful combination that is also highly efficient. The Prius boasts an EPA-estimated fuel economy of 57 MPG city, 56 MPG highway, and 57 MPG combined, saving you both time and money at the pump. Exterior On the outside, the Prius is stylish and modern. Its 17-inch alloy wheels, active grille shutter, and LED daytime running lights give it a clean, refined silhouette while a roof-mounted shark-fin antenna adds a touch of sportiness to the overall look. Heated power outside mirrors, Bi-LED projector headlights, and LED taillights and stop lights are also included for your safety and convenience. Interior The inside of the Prius features a comfortable and spacious cabin. Cloth-trimmed front seats and 60/40 split-bench seats in the back allow for four passengers, while the rear seats can be folded down to increase the total cargo capacity. A single zone climate control system with pollen filtration is also included on the base trim, as well as six USB-C charge ports and a center console with additional storage space. Technology Toyota has included all the latest infotainment tech in the 2025 Prius. An 8-inch multimedia touchscreen comes standard on the base trim, along with a 6-speaker audio system and support for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. The Prius also features a 30-day trial of a Wi-Fi Connect hotspot, as well as a 1-year subscription to Remote Connect, which lets you remotely interact with your vehicle via the Toyota app on your smartwatch. Safety When it comes to safety, Toyota always makes sure to include the best of the best driver assistance features. Toyota's Star Safety System comes standard and includes enhanced vehicle stability control, traction control, an anti-lock brake system, electronic brake-force distribution, brake assist, and smart stop technology. The Prius also has Toyota Safety Sense 3.0, which includes several advanced driver assistance features, such as dynamic radar cruise control, lane departure alert with steering assist, lane tracing assist, road sign assist, and automatic highbeams, to name a few. Lower Anchors and Tethers for Children (LATCH) comes standard as well. The Toyota Prius is well-known in the world of hybrid vehicles for a good reason. Five Signs Your Toyota Needs a Tire Alignment

Poorly aligned tires can have a big effect on how efficiently your car runs and how it feels to drive. If you notice any of the warning signs, you can schedule a tire alignment service at your local Toyota dealership. 1. Off-Center Steering Wheel When you drive or park in a straight line, your steering wheel should also be straight, reflecting the direction that your tires are pointing. If there's a problem with the alignment, you'll have to move the steering wheel off-center to get your tires straight. This can be disorienting and make it difficult to carry out maneuvers without having to make adjustments. 2. Pulling to One Side The tires on your car should all point directly forward when in a neutral position, creating a rectangle. When the tires are out of alignment, one or more of the tires points in a different direction. When the car is in motion, the misaligned tire will attempt to move forward at this angle, causing your Toyota to pull to one side. There are other causes of your car pulling to the side, but misaligned tires are one of the most common. 3. Increased Fuel Consumption Keeping track of your Toyota's fuel consumption can help alert you when something changes. If you have poorly aligned tires, you may notice you are having to fill up with gas more frequently. This is because misaligned tires create rolling resistance, forcing your engine to work harder to achieve the same mileage and speed. 4. Bumpy Ride Your tires and suspension are designed to work in perfect harmony, so when there's a problem with one, the other will struggle. Misaligned tires cause excess stress on your suspension, making it harder for bumps in the road surface to be absorbed efficiently. Left unchecked, misaligned tires can cause permanent damage to the suspension. 5. Cabin Vibrations If your tires are pulling in different directions, they will be fighting against each other as you travel. This can be felt through the steering wheel as vibrations, particularly at high speeds. Poor alignment can also lead to varying degrees of wear, which causes inconsistent contact with the surface. This can also lead to vibrations as the tires won't be rotating smoothly.
